Automatic screen printing machine production details
Maximum print size: 2000 × 1200 mm or on request
Minimum print size: 600 × 800mm or upon request
Printed glass thickness: 3-19mm
Glass transmission direction: short side first
Maximum frame size: 2600×1500mm
Glass loading rate: printing size 2200×1500mm/approx. 25S
Mechanical repeatability: ±0.2mm
Synchronous screen release range: 0-60mm.
Transmission speed: 4m/min-30m/min
Table flatness: ±0.2 mm/m
Cleaning height: approx. 450mm
Direction of squeegee movement: opposite to the direction of transmission
Scraping speed: 0.2-0.5m/s
Conveyor height: 930±20mm
Power supply: PH+G 380V 50HZ
Power: approx. 12kw
Air demand: 6Kg/cm2
Suitable temperature: 18℃-38℃
Transmission mode:
Adopt the brand brake motor, through the chain to the stick shaft conveyor drive glass sheet, the stick shaft is equipped with wear-resistant solvent-resistant rubber ring to drive the glass sheet conveyor, with Japan Mitsubishi inverter, so that the glass sheet in the process of conveying smooth and safe.
Lifting mode of conveying frame:
The glass sheet conveying frame adopts pneumatic lifting, and is equipped with photoelectric sensor to fully automatic control and glass feeding position, accurate positioning.
Head lift:
The head lift adopts international brand worm gear reducer, which is transmitted by chain, and the head is self-locking at any position, with cylinder safety protection device and fiber optic safety protection device at the wiping plate position to ensure the safety performance of the machine. Lifting guide bar adopts German (INA) brand. The highest position and the lowest position are equipped with double protection switch and accidental safety protection device to prevent the machine from being damaged and the operator’s safety from being lifted too far.
Precise positioning:
Precise positioning with 8 positioning points, using the cylinder two-way drive (up drive, lateral drive), positioning pulley using imported linear guide, with precision ball screw adjustment positioning, to ensure accurate positioning. And equipped with adjusting hand wheel, position display and adjusting locking device. The adjustment distance can be adjusted arbitrarily between the largest glass piece and the smallest glass piece. When positioning, the positioning pulley is raised to the surface, and when printing, the positioning pulley is lowered to below the surface, so as to ensure the printing of various thicknesses of glass.
Printing and ink return device:
The printing and inking movement adopts servo stepping motor, which drives the German-made MEGADYNE synchronous belt. With the precision linear guide pulling the printing beam for oil sealing and printing. Through the servo-stepping system (servo-stepping system features: fast speed, high positioning accuracy, stable operation.) To achieve the stepless speed adjustment of printing and oil sealing. The scraper and oil return knife are driven by cylinder and equipped with air pressure adjustment device. The cylinder pressure can be adjusted according to different printing. The angle of scraper and oil return knife is adjustable from 0 to 35º. Printing has single printing, double printing two functions.
Screening mechanism:
Adopt servo stepping motor to drive the off-screen structure design, to achieve the real printing off-screen synchronization effect. With the scraping action synchronized with the plate frame raised, and with automatic rapid reset device, not to produce shock waves and elastic fatigue. For a variety of different viscosity ink, different tension of the screen plate when scraping to reduce the shadow, deformation, sticky plate to meet a variety of high-precision printing.
Printing auto glass thickness adjustment:
The head is equipped with an adjusting handle and position indicator, which can adjust the distance from the screen to the printed material by changing the position of the contact to the photoelectric switch.
Screen printing plate clamping and adjusting device:
The screen plate is pushed in by the operation side, the screen plate clamping adopts short side pneumatic clamping, at the same time auxiliary manual locking device to ensure that the screen plate does not move after work without air source state, the adjustment device is equipped with four X.Y.Z. scale, the adjustment handle to the screen plate when the front, back, left and right direction adjustment, the adjustment distance ± 15mm.
Printing table working surface:
The table frame is made of aluminum alloy, and the internal stress is eliminated through heat treatment process to ensure no deformation, and the table is divided into several pieces according to the requirements of transmission, positioning and minimum printing size, and each piece can be adjusted independently when assembled. The working table surface is treated with aluminum and titanium alloy surface Teflon process. The table surface is flat, rust-proof and resistant to corrosion, and the plane accuracy of the table is ±0.15mm/m.
Suction and blowing device:
When the glass piece is precisely positioned, the fan blows on the glass piece to form a layer of air cushion between the glass piece and the table plate to prevent the glass piece from being scratched. After the positioning is completed, the blowing air is converted to suction air, and the glass sheet is strongly adsorbed on the table plate when printing to improve the printing accuracy.
Auxiliary stencil device:
The auxiliary stencil rises and falls with the lifting and lowering conveyor, which reduces the vibration of the squeegee to the glass sheet when printing to improve the quality of the printed products, the lifting distance of the stencil is 40mm, and there is a front and rear adjustment slot, so that the stencil can be adjusted according to the size of the printed products. Screen printing control system:
Adopt Japanese Mitsubishi PLC, human-machine interface centralized control, and equipped with fault prompting system. Printing speed, pre-positioning time and conveying speed are all regulated by frequency converter, which is convenient, safe and reliable to operate and can be designed and modified according to customer’s requirements.
